In △ABC, point D∈ AB with AD:DB=5:3, point E∈ BC so that BE:EC=1:4. If AABC=40 in2, find AADC, ABDC, and ACDE.

Answer: Using the proportions between the segments, the area of the triangles are:

1. Area of triangle ADC is 25 in^2.

2. Area of triangle BDC is 15 in^2.

3. Area of triangle CDE is 12 in^2.
